From the Manga "Yu-Gi-Oh! ARC-V The Strongest Duelist Yuya!"

Dragon Force
Continuous Spell Card
Once per turn, during your Main Phase: You can Fusion Summon 1 Dragon Fusion monster from your Extra Deck, using monsters from your hand or field as Fusion materials. For a Synchro or Xyz Summon of a Dragon monster, you can also use monsters from your hand as material. Once per turn, when a Dragon monster you control that was summoned from the Extra Deck destroys an opponents monster by battle: Special Summon the destroyed card to your side of the field. You can only activate 1 "Dragon Force" per turn.

The effects aren't shabby at all, though since it's a Continuous Spell the effects can be stopped before resolution by blowing the card up (I think??).  Seems like a card that might make the opponent think hard about whether or not they want to use a removal on this card, since it could make for some scary plays otherwise. However, since it isn't searchable like Polymerization or archetypal fusion spells and is a "do-nothing" card on its own, it isn't as powerful as it looks at first glance. You'd have to hard-draw it in the decks that would want to use it, so you'd either run 3 or zero.  The Synchro and Xyz effects are strictly better than the Fusion effect since most decks that are fusing big dragons have archetypal Fusion spells that are searchable.  The best dragon decks out there tend to have a lot of 1-card combo starters that can end on multiple big dragon synchro or Xyz monsters as it is.

The idea is a neat one, but with it not being searchable by the decks that would want to use it, it's more of an Anime-Protagonist-Epic-Moment card.
